4-channel thermocouple/mV input module
| Input signal, configurable | True |
| Output signal configurable | False |
| Number Of Channels | 4 point |
| Input channel configuration | Via configuration software screen or the user prog (by writing a unique bit pattern into the module’s configuration file) |
| Response speed per channel | Input filter and configuration dependent |
| Channel diagnostics | Over or under range or open circuit condition by bit reporting for analog inputs |
| Input, voltage | False |
| Output, voltage | False |
| Rated working voltage | 30V DC |
| Common mode voltage range | ±10V |
| Bus current draw | 50mA @ 24V DC, maximum |
| Input, current | False |
| Output, current | False |
| I/O Isolation | Isolated |
| Input group to bus isolation | 30V AC/30V DC working voltage type test: 720V DC @ 1min |
| Input and output group to system isolation | 30V AC/30V DC working voltage type test: 500V AC or 707V DC @ 1min |
